AGENCY:
Federal Aviation Administration (FAA), DOT.
ACTION:
Notice of proposed rulemaking.
SUMMARY:
This action proposes to amend fourteen Federal airways in the vicinity of Dallas/Fort Worth, TX. The FAA is proposing this action to simplify the airway structure, thereby, enhancing the management of aircraft operations in the area.

Background
On October 10, 1996, the Dallas/Fort Worth Metroplex Plan (DFW/MP) was implemented. The DFW/MP was a major airspace redesign project which, in part, decommissioned four Very High Frequency Omnidirectional Range/Tactical Air Navigation (VORTAC) and relocated and commissioned four new VORTAC facilities. The four new navigational VORTAC facilities were designed to enhance the management of aircraft operations in the vicinity of DFW. In support of the DFW/MP, the FAA amended twelve VOR Federal airways (61 FR 41736). However, since the implementation of this amended Federal airway structure the FAA has discovered that further amendment of the existing airway structure would improve aircraft movement and thus management of the navigable airspace in the DFW area. Therefore, revisions to the current airway system in the DFW area are necessary.
The Proposal
The FAA is proposing to amend part 71 of Title 14 Code of Federal Regulations to revise fourteen Federal airways in the vicinity of Dallas/Fort Worth, TX. The proposed rule would amend the following Federal airways: V-15, V-16, V-17, V-566 by modifying the route descriptions; V-63, V-69, V-131, V-305, V-507, V-573 by amending the start points; and V-66, V-163, V-358, and V-407 by modifying the end points. The FAA is proposing this action to simplify the airway structure, thereby, enhancing the management of aircraft operations in the area.
The FAA has determined that this regulation only involves an established body of technical regulations for which frequent and routine amendments are necessary to keep them operationally current. It, therefore—(1) is not a “significant regulatory action” under Executive Order 12866; (2) is not a “significant rule” under Department of Transportation (DOT) Regulatory Policies and Procedures (44 FR 11034, February 26, 1979); and (3) does not warrant preparation of a Regulatory Evaluation as the anticipated impact is so minimal. Since this is a routine matter that will only affect air traffic procedures and air navigation, it is certified that this rule, when promulgated, will not have a significant economic impact on a substantial number of small entities under the criteria of the Regulatory Flexibility Act.
Federal airways are published in paragraph 6010(a) of FAA Order 7400.9G dated September 1, 1999, and effective September 16, 1999, which is incorporated by reference in 14 CFR 71.1. The Federal airways listed in this document would be published subsequently in the Order.

Paragraph 6010(a) Domestic VOR Federal Airways
V-15 [Revised]
From Hobby, TX, via Navasota, TX; College Station, TX; Waco, TX; Cedar Creek, TX; Bonham, TX; McAlester, OK; Okmulgee, OK; to Neosho, MO. From Sioux City, IA; INT Sioux City 340° and Sioux Falls, SD, 169° radials; Sioux Falls; Huron, SD; Aberdeen, SD; Bismarck, ND; to Minot, ND.
V-16 [Revised]
From Los Angeles, CA; Paradise, CA; Palm Springs, CA; Blythe, CA; Buckeye, AZ; Phoenix, AZ; INT Phoenix 155° and Stanfield, AZ, 105° radials; Tucson, AZ; Cochise, AZ; Columbus, NM; El Paso, TX; Salt Flat, TX; Wink, TX; INT Wink 066° and Big Spring, TX, 260° radials; Big Spring; Abilene, TX; Bowie, TX; Bonham, TX; Paris, TX; Texarkana, AR; Pine Bluff, AR; Marvell, AR; Holly Springs, MS; Jacks Creek, TN; Shelbyville, TN; Hinch Mountain, TN; Volunteer, TN; Holston Mountain, TN; Pulaski, VA; Roanoke, VA; Lynchburg, VA; Flat Rock, VA; Richmond, VA; INT Richmond 039° and Patuxent, MD, 228° radials; Patuxent; Smyrna, DE; Cedar Lake, NJ; Coyle, NJ; INT Coyle 036° and Kennedy, NY, 209° radials; Kennedy; Deer Park, NY; Calverton, NY; Norwich, CT; Boston, MA. The airspace within Mexico and the airspace below 2,000 feet MSL outside the United States is excluded. The airspace within Restricted Areas R-5002A, R-5002C, and R-5002D is excluded during their times of use. The airspace within Restricted Areas R-4005 and R-4006 is excluded.
V-17 [Revised]
From Brownsville, TX, via Harlingen, TX; McAllen, TX; 29 miles 12 AGL, 34 miles 25 MSL, 37 miles 12 AGL; Laredo, TX; Cotulla, TX; INT Cotulla 046° and San Antonio, TX, 198° radials; San Antonio; Centex, TX; Waco, TX; Glen Rose, TX; Millsap, TX; Bowie, TX; Ardmore, OK; Will Rogers, OK; Gage, OK; Garden City, KS; to Goodland, KS.
V-63 [Revised]
From Bowie, TX; Texoma, OK; McAlester, OK; Razorback, AR; Springfield, MO; Hallsville, MO; Quincy, IL; Burlington, IA; Moline, IL; Davenport, IA; Rockford, IL; Janesville, WI; Badger, WI; Oshkosh, WI; Stevens Point, WI; Wausau, WI; Rhinelander, WI; to Houghton, MI. Excluding that airspace at and above 10,000 feet MSL from 5 NM north to 46 NM north of Quincy during the time that the Howard West MOA is activated by NOTAM.
V-66 [Revised]
From Mission Bay, CA; Imperial, CA; 13 miles, 24 miles, 25 MSL; Bard, AZ; 12 miles, 35 MSL; INT Bard 089° and Gila Bend, AZ, 261° radials; 46 miles, 35 MSL; Gila Bend; Tucson, AZ, 7 miles wide (3 miles south and 4 miles north of centerline); Douglas, AZ; INT Douglas 064° and Columbus, NM, 277° radials; Columbus; El Paso, TX; 6 miles wide; INT El Paso 109° and Hudspeth 287° radials; 6 miles wide; Hudspeth; Pecos, TX; Midland, TX; INT Midland 083° and Abilene, TX, 252° radials; Abilene; to Millsap, TX.
V-69 [Revised]
From El Dorado, AR; Pine Bluff, AR; INT Pine Bluff 038° and Walnut Ridge, AR, 187° radials; Walnut Ridge; Farmington, MO; Troy, IL; Capital, IL; Pontiac, IL; to Joliet, IL.
V-131 [Revised]
From Okmulgee, OK; Tulsa, OK; Chanute, KS; to Topeka, KS. Start Printed Page 36807
V-163 [Revised]
From Matamoros, Mexico; via Brownsville, TX; 27 miles standard width, 37 miles 7 miles wide (3 miles E and 4 miles W of centerline); Corpus Christi, TX; Three Rivers, TX; INT Three Rivers 345° and San Antonio, TX, 168° radials; San Antonio; Lampasas, TX; to Glen Rose, TX.
V-305 [Revised]
From El Dorado, AR; Little Rock, AR; Walnut Ridge, AR; Malden, MO; Cunningham, KY; Pocket City, IN; INT Pocket City 046° and Hoosier, IN, 205° radials; Hoosier; INT Hoosier 025° and Brickyard, IN, 185° radials; Brickyard; INT Brickyard 038° and Kokomo, IN, 182° radials; Kokomo.
V-358 [Revised]
From San Antonio, TX, via Stonewall, TX; Lampasas, TX; INT Lampasas 041° and Waco, TX, 249° radials; Waco.
V-407 [Revised]
From Harlingen, TX; via INT Harlingen 006° and Corpus Christi, TX, 193° radials; Corpus Christi; via INT Corpus Christi 039° and Palacios, TX, 241° radials; Palacios; via INT Palacios 017° and Humble, TX, 242° radials; Humble; Daisetta, TX; Lufkin, TX; Elm Grove, LA; to El Dorado, AR.
V-507 [Revised]
From Ardmore, OK; Will Rogers, OK, via INT Will Rogers 284° and Gage, OK, 152° radials; Gage; Liberal, KS; to Garden City, KS.
V-566 [Revised]
From Gregg County, TX; Belcher, LA; Elm Grove, LA; Alexandria, LA; INT Alexandria 109° and Reserve, LA, 323° radials; Reserve; excluding the portion within R-3801B and R-3801C.
V-573 [Revised]
From Will Rogers, OK; INT Will Rogers 195°T(188°M) and Ardmore, OK, 327°(321°M) radials; Ardmore; Bonham, TX; Sulpher Springs, TX; Texarkana, AR; INT Texarkana 037° and Hot Springs, AR, 225° radials; Hot Springs; to Little Rock, AR.
